The Newfoundland dog breed originated from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ada. They are large, powerful working dogs. Newfoundlands can grow up to 28 inches tall and up to 150 pounds. They are very active and love to go swimming, walking, and hiking. You will need to stay up-to-date with grooming and nutrition for a happy pup! A Newfoundland puppy needs at least a half-hour of exercise a day to keep them happy and healthy.

Newfoundland For Sale: About the Breed

If you're looking for a devoted, sweet, hard-working dog breed, a Newfoundland puppy for sale may be the perfect fit for you.

The Newfoundland dog breed is believed to have originated from Newfoundland and Labrador, Canada, but several accounts differ in the history and origin of a Newfoundland puppy for sale. What we do know is these dogs were originally bred to assist fishermen in their work, as their large size and strong swimming ability made them ideal for tasks such as pulling carts, retrieving nets, and rescuing people from the water.

The breed's loyalty and gentle nature also made them popular as family pets. Today, Newfoundland puppies are known for their strength, loyalty, and affectionate temperament. Characteristics

A Newfoundland is a large dog with muscular legs, a massive head, a dense bone structure, and displays a dignified, regal manner. A Newfoundland puppy will charm you with soulful eyes and a gentle spirit.

Their thick, double coats come in a variety of colors, including black, brown, gray, beige, white & black, black & tan, and white & brown color combinations. You may want to keep some towels handy because a Newfoundland puppy is a heavy drooler.

Activity Level

One might wonder due to its working history and size if a Newfy puppy for sale is a high-energy dog, but you may be interested to find that they're not too hyper and not too lazy. They have moderate activity needs and are equally happy thinking they are lap dogs for a cuddle session or going on a hike with you.

Disposition

If you're wondering, "What is the personality like of a Newfoundland puppy for sale near me?" you'll learn they're gentle giants. They are naturally curious without being skittish and are very outgoing. In fact, they don't like to be away from people and fit right in as a member of the family. A Newfoundland puppy for sale is not a big barker unless alerting its people to something amiss.

Newfoundland puppies for sale are amazing choices for families. They love being around children, other dogs, and people, making them pleasant and loyal companions. They've rightfully earned the nickname "nanny dog," and Nana from J. M. Barrie's Peter Pan novel is undoubtedly the most famous nanny Newfie.

Training

A Newfoundland puppy loves to please its owners and is intelligent, making the perfect combination for a successful training experience. In addition to basic training, a Newfoundland puppy can be introduced to water and dog sports as early as four months of age if they are to be working dogs.

Grooming Needs & Care

When you search for "Newfoundland puppies for sale near me," one of the first things you may notice is that magnificent, longhaired coat. A Newfy's coat is built perfectly to withstand the harsh weather of Newfoundland and Labrador as a working dog. Their double coat has a coarse, outer layer and a fine, lofty-haired undercoat. Newfoundland puppies for sale shed their coat year-round, so you must stay on top of brushing them several times a week with both a long-toothed comb and a slicker brush to remove dead hair, remove mats and debris, and keep their coat looking tidy.

Despite their long hair, Newfoundland puppies do not need regular haircuts. Professional grooming visits may include baths, nail trim, anal glands expression, ear and eye checks, and checking dental health.

Cost

Looking for a Newfoundland puppy with a superior lineage? Are you trying to determine how much a Newfoundland with breeding rights and papers would cost? You should expect to pay a premium for a Newfoundland puppy with breeding rights or show quality with papers. You should budget anywhere from $1,500 upwards to $5,970 or even more for Newfoundland puppies for sale with top breed lines and a superior pedigree. The average cost for all Newfoundland puppies for sale is $3,470.
